Output ffabecdc136a76ef7fbbf9e36bacbe75c8fc3ed8db71eebb218f9e53f6d5b2cd:1

value
4412557
script pubkey
OP_0 OP_PUSHBYTES_20 2d2d3e56849bfc646218886b8938a4815b1d674e
address
bc1q95knu45yn07xgcsc3p4cjw9ys9d36e6wam83a0
transaction
ffabecdc136a76ef7fbbf9e36bacbe75c8fc3ed8db71eebb218f9e53f6d5b2cd
confirmations
109436
spent
true